Regeneron's Preclinical Manufacturing & Process Development (PMPD) Analytics group is seeking a laboratory Scientist or Engineer interested in the analytical characterization of biopharmaceuticals.

The Process Development Analytics group core mission is to analyze samples received by PMPD subgroups and provide quality and impurity data, and to characterize and optimize assay robustness, precision, and accuracy. Tech development and automation is also prioritized to further optimize assays and resources.

In this role, you will conduct analytical experiments that support manufacturing process development and research activities in a fast-paced, high-throughput laboratory setting.


A Typical Day in the Role of Process Development Associate 2, Analytics Might Look Like:

  • Conduct high throughput biophysical/biochemical analysis of samples generated during manufacturing process development and research projects.
  • Conduct experiments to further statistical understanding of assay performance and interpret the results in collaboration with cross-functional groups.
  • Deliver written or oral communications as a representative of the PMPD Analytics group at a wide variety of internal projects.
  • Collaborate with team members and supervisor to develop novel analytical assays and investigate new analytical technologies.
  • Contributes to continuous improvement efforts for increasing efficiency and throughput within the PMPD Analytics group.

This Role Might Be For You If You Have:

  • A working knowledge of modern methods of protein research, such as liquid chromatography, capillary electrophoresis, and immunoassays.
  • An interest in high throughput analytical methodologies, and their use in biopharmaceutical manufacturing process development.
  • An interest in joining a collaborative team with a focus on continuous improvement.

This role requires a BS with 0 – 2 years of relevant experience. A good understanding of the principles and practice in one or more fields of analytical methodology is desirable. Knowledge of statistical analyses and statistical design of experiments is a plus.

Regeneron is a leading biotechnology company that invents life-transforming medicines for people with serious diseases. Founded and led for 30 years by physician-scientists, our unique ability to repeatedly and consistently translate science into medicine has led to seven FDA-approved treatments and numerous product candidates in development, all of which were homegrown in our laboratories. Our medicines and pipeline are designed to help patients with eye disease, allergic and inflammatory diseases, cancer, cardiovascular and metabolic diseases, infectious diseases, pain and rare diseases.
 
Regeneron is accelerating and improving the traditional drug development process through our proprietary VelociSuite® technologies, such as VelocImmune® which produces optimized fully-human antibodies, and ambitious research initiatives such as the Regeneron Genetics Center, which is conducting one of the largest genetics sequencing efforts in the world.
